Overview

This position supports the work of the Y, a leading nonprofit, charitable organization committed to strengthening community through youth development, healthy living and social responsibility. The Woodwork Specialist at the YMCA of Northern Utah maintains a supportive, positive atmosphere that welcomes and respects all individuals, promotes the potential of all youth, and provides a quality experience to both youth and their families. The   Woodwork specialist is responsible for planning and implementing an engaging Woodwork program at camp. This is a seasonal position.

Responsibilities

  • Develops and maintains a high quality Woodwork curriculum that promotes safety, engagement, and connection with all age groups camp serves.
  • Responsible for working with a cabin group of youth ensuring their physical and emotional safety is secured for the duration of the camp session while making every effort to progress each camper's development by maintaining a supportive, positive atmosphere that welcomes and respects all individuals, promotes the potential of all youth, and provides a quality experience to both youth and their families.
  • Provide camp leadership with an inventory list for program supplies needed for the curriculum that fall within budget limits prior to summer
  • Weekly inventory checks on all Woodwork equipment, ensuring all equipment is fit for use.
  • Advise Camp leadership on any Woodwork equipment/supplies need to be replaced.
  • Follows all policies, procedures, and standards as established by the law or the Y (e.g., safety or emergency procedures, behavior guidance strategies, child abuse prevention policies); makes ADA accommodations where appropriate; maintains the program site, equipment, and required program records.
  • Nurtures youth through purposeful programming; plans activities that are intended to achieve program goals and outcomes, are culturally relevant, are developmentally appropriate, and are consistent with the Y's values.
  • Creates a positive rapport and shared interest with all youth; models relationship-building skills in all interactions.
  • Provides opportunities for youth to lead, problem-solve, and make decisions and choices within the program and provides daily opportunities for youth to reflect on and respond to their experiences.
  • Provides and welcomes ongoing dialogue with parents and caregivers about their child's needs and progress; connects families to the Y.
  • Attends and participates in family nights, program activities, staff meetings, and staff training.
  • Work alongside entire camp staff throughout the program week and on the last day of program to clean the facility.

WORK ENVIRONMENT & PHYSICAL DEMANDS:

The physical demands described here are representative of those that must be met by an employee to successfully perform the essential functions of this job. Reasonable accommodations may be made to enable individuals with disabilities to perform the essential functions.

  • Ability to plan, lead, and participate in program activities in a variety of indoor and/or outdoor settings.
  • Ability to work in excess of a 40-hour week with irregular work hours.
  • Ability to walk, stand, and sit (including on the ground) for long periods of time.
  • Staff are expected to live on site during the work week (Sunday-Friday). Staff can expect to work long hours, with 1-hour minimum break time during full workdays.
  • Exposure to communicable diseases and bodily fluids.
  • Must be able to lift and/or assist children up to 50 pounds in weight.
  • May be exposed to adverse outdoor weather conditions and air quality at elevations 8,000-10,000 ft
  • Ability to respond appropriately and effectively to emergency situations such as but not limited to fire evacuations, severe weather, or a missing camper.


Qualifications

  • High school diploma or equivalent; one year or more of college preferred.
  • Meets minimum age standards as established by state law and/or the Y.
  • CPR, First Aid, and AED certifications required; will be provided in training if candidate does not have current certification
  • Previous experience working with children in a camp setting preferred.
  • Previous experience with woodworking preferred.
  • Previous experience in one or more areas of camp programming.
  • Previous experience working with diverse populations.
  • Ability to develop positive, authentic relationships with people from different backgrounds.
  • Commitment to inclusion and compliance with the Americans with Disabilities Act (ADA).
